    Hi John

    I/we would class smart casual as shoes, long trousers and a shirt, many ex services will of course wear suits, blazer and medals. However that does not mean you would be turned away for wearing shorts and a shirt, as far as we are concerned paying your respects is just as important as what you are wearing.

    The Embassy service is run by the Embassy on Remembrance Sunday, we attend it but have nothing to do with the running of it, they have certainly not been taken over by Legion Branches even though we are the Custodians of Remembrance (we do take over the Social Club after the Service!!).

    Remembrance Services as far as I am concerned should be kept short, simple and to the point, on our service on the 11th there will be 10 poppy wreaths layed, 3 of those by schools (it is after all very important to involve them) the other 7 by invited guests (representatives from the British Embassy, the Royal British Legion, Thailand, Honorary Consuls, VFW and other groups). There will be no individual wreaths, however there will be a Garden of Remembrance outside the front of the church where individuals may, if they wish place a small wooden poppy cross with the name of an loved one they have lost in the garden, those same crosses will also be placed in the British Embassy the following Sunday.

    This will be our first Remembrance Day Service in Pattaya so it will of course be a learning curve as regards how many attend but as I have said it will be simple and traditional.

  9. The Royal British Legion are fairly well established now in a number of areas of Thailand, Pattaya, Korat and Chiang Mai but we could certainly do with more members from the Bangkok area. We are fast approaching Remembrancetide when we will be putting out collection boxes in a number of bars, restaurants and even International Schools within Bangkok, we could certainly use a little help doing this. We will also be attending the Remembrance Service at the British Embassy on Sunday 14th November, a first for us this year will be a full Service of Remembrance at 10.30am on Thursday 11th November at St Nikolaus Church Pattaya.

    It's not all work, whilst our primary role is the care and welfare of those who have served, are serving (within the UK Armed Forces) and/or their dependents we also have a very active social calendar including trips to the the River Kwai for ANZAC Day and Malaysia every June.

    Our man in Bangkok is Antony Bell who has already approached a friendly Landlord willing to host the group and offer discounts to members, you can contact Tony at [email protected] who will be able to provide you with an on line application form, details of where they intend to meet etc, it's a great way to both get involved and make new friends. You do NOT have to have served in the Armed Forces to join.

    Just to put things right Fredob, you are talking about a Fish called "John Dory", a very nice tasing fish that yes has an imprint either side. You are correct, very nice steamed and very expensive. There are some places within Pattaya that actually advertise fish as John Dory when it is not!!!.

    Our Dory is advertised on the menu as Pacific Dory, the same as most restuarants in Pattaya, a nice white fillet that goes well with batter, that is relitivly cheap.
